What’s The Opportunity

Are you an experienced senior Civil Engineer passionate about shaping infrastructure, residential communities, and water solutions? If you are ready to lead a team delivering innovative designs for major development projects, you will be a key member of a team that values collaboration and innovation.

In this role you will lead and grow our civil engineering discipline, focusing on infrastructure design for large-scale residential developments, highways, drainage, utilities, and water sector projects. You will work on schemes that transform communities, from strategic masterplans to detailed engineering solutions for sustainable water management.

What you need to do to be effective in this role

  • Lead, manage, and grow the Civil Engineering discipline.
  • Deliver infrastructure and residential development projects, including highways, drainage, utilities, and water sector solutions.
  • Develop and maintain client relationships, whilst identifying new opportunities.
  • Drive business growth through new and repeat clients.
  • Manage resources and deliver projects to financial targets.
  • Ensure compliance with technical standards and planning requirements.
  • Represent Ridge at external meetings with clients, local authorities, and stakeholders.
  • Oversee project profitability, budgets, and fee negotiations.
  • Build and lead technical teams using internal and external resources.
  • Champion technical excellence within Civil Engineering.

The core skills and experience you need to have for this role

  • Degree-qualified in Civil Engineering or related discipline.
  • Chartered Engineer (or near Chartered).
  • Proven experience in infrastructure design for residential and mixed-use developments and water sector projects.
  • Strong technical knowledge of highways, drainage, utilities, and water management.
  • Ability to communicate complex solutions clearly to clients and stakeholders.
